Analysis

In 2022, cash surplus/deficit as a proportion of gdp in New Zealand stood at -35.5%.

The figure is down 5.7% on the previous year and down 1.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, cash surplus/deficit as a proportion of gdp in New Zealand peaked at -29.7% in 2018 and was at its lowest, -40.0%, in 2011.

New Zealand ranks 128th of 162 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 22 years of available data.

Cash surplus/deficit as a proportion of GDP in New Zealand, year by year

Annual values for Cash surplus/deficit as a proportion of GDP (%) in New Zealand, 2001 to 2022.
Year Value Change
2001 -31.6%
2002 -30.7% -2.6%
2003 -31.2% +1.6%
2004 -30.4% -2.5%
2005 -31.0% +1.8%
2006 -31.4% +1.3%
2007 -31.3% -0.2%
2008 -32.6% +4.0%
2009 -34.1% +4.6%
2010 -34.1% +0.3%
2011 -40.0% +17.3%
2012 -35.0% -12.7%
2013 -33.1% -5.4%
2014 -32.3% -2.3%
2015 -31.5% -2.5%
2016 -30.7% -2.6%
2017 -29.9% -2.6%
2018 -29.7% -0.7%
2019 -30.1% +1.3%
2020 -36.3% +20.9%
2021 -33.6% -7.5%
2022 -35.5% +5.7%
